Searched refs:vm_size_t (Results 1 - 25 of 172) sorted by relevance

1234567

/xnu-2422.115.4/osfmk/kern/
H A Dkalloc.h67 extern void *kalloc(vm_size_t size);
69 extern void *kalloc_noblock(vm_size_t size);
72 vm_size_t size);
86 vm_size_t *cur_size,
87 vm_size_t *max_size,
88 vm_size_t *elem_size,
89 vm_size_t *alloc_size,
95 extern vm_size_t kalloc_max_prerounded;
96 extern vm_size_t kalloc_large_total;
H A Dzalloc.h113 vm_size_t cur_size; /* current memory utilization */
114 vm_size_t max_size; /* how large can this zone grow */
115 vm_size_t elem_size; /* size of an element */
116 vm_size_t alloc_size; /* size used for more memory */
149 vm_size_t prio_refill_watermark;
178 vm_size_t map_size);
189 vm_size_t *cur_size,
190 vm_size_t *max_size,
191 vm_size_t *elem_size,
192 vm_size_t *alloc_siz
[all...]
H A Dkext_alloc.h38 kern_return_t kext_alloc(vm_offset_t *addr, vm_size_t size, boolean_t fixed);
40 void kext_free(vm_offset_t addr, vm_size_t size);
H A Dkalloc.c83 zone_t kalloc_zone(vm_size_t);
89 vm_size_t kalloc_max;
90 vm_size_t kalloc_max_prerounded;
91 vm_size_t kalloc_kernmap_size; /* size of kallocs that can come from kernel map */
94 vm_size_t kalloc_large_total;
95 vm_size_t kalloc_large_max;
96 vm_size_t kalloc_largest_allocated = 0;
112 KALLOC_ZINFO_SALLOC(vm_size_t bytes)
126 KALLOC_ZINFO_SFREE(vm_size_t bytes)
301 vm_size_t siz
[all...]
H A Dmisc_protos.h84 vm_size_t nbytes);
90 vm_size_t max,
91 vm_size_t *actual);
103 vm_size_t nbytes);
115 extern int copyin_validate(const user_addr_t, uintptr_t, vm_size_t);
116 extern int copyout_validate(uintptr_t, const user_addr_t, vm_size_t);
/xnu-2422.115.4/libsyscall/mach/
H A Dmig_deallocate.c60 mig_deallocate(vm_address_t addr, vm_size_t size)
H A Dmach_init.c71 vm_size_t vm_kernel_page_size = KERNEL_PAGE_SIZE;
72 vm_size_t vm_kernel_page_mask = KERNEL_PAGE_MASK;
75 vm_size_t vm_page_size = PAGE_SIZE;
76 vm_size_t vm_page_mask = PAGE_MASK;
88 host_page_size(__unused host_t host, vm_size_t *out_page_size)
H A Dmig_allocate.c60 mig_allocate(vm_address_t *addr_p, vm_size_t size)
H A Dport_obj.c52 (vm_size_t)(maxsize * sizeof (*port_obj_table)),
/xnu-2422.115.4/libsyscall/mach/mach/
H A Dvm_page_size.h37 extern vm_size_t vm_kernel_page_size __OSX_AVAILABLE_STARTING(__MAC_10_9, __IPHONE_7_0);
38 extern vm_size_t vm_kernel_page_mask __OSX_AVAILABLE_STARTING(__MAC_10_9, __IPHONE_7_0);
H A Dmach_init.h73 extern kern_return_t host_page_size(host_t, vm_size_t *);
105 extern vm_size_t vm_page_size;
106 extern vm_size_t vm_page_mask;
/xnu-2422.115.4/osfmk/i386/
H A Dio_map_entries.h43 vm_size_t size,
45 extern vm_offset_t io_map_spec(vm_map_offset_t phys_addr, vm_size_t size, unsigned int flags);
/xnu-2422.115.4/osfmk/vm/
H A Dvm_kern.h78 vm_size_t size,
98 vm_size_t size,
107 vm_size_t size);
112 vm_size_t size);
117 vm_size_t size);
122 vm_size_t oldsize,
124 vm_size_t newsize);
129 vm_size_t size);
134 vm_size_t size,
143 vm_size_t siz
[all...]
H A Dcpm.h56 cpm_allocate(vm_size_t size, vm_page_t *list, ppnum_t max_pnum, ppnum_t pnum_mask, boolean_t wire, int flags);
/xnu-2422.115.4/security/
H A Dmac_alloc.h45 void * mac_kalloc (vm_size_t size, int how);
46 void mac_kfree (void *data, vm_size_t size);
63 zone_t mac_zinit (vm_size_t size, vm_size_t maxmem,
64 vm_size_t alloc, const char *name);
H A Dmac_alloc.c54 mac_kalloc(vm_size_t size, int how)
66 void * mac_kalloc_noblock (vm_size_t size);
68 mac_kalloc_noblock(vm_size_t size)
74 mac_kfree(void * data, vm_size_t size)
141 mac_zinit(vm_size_t size, vm_size_t maxmem, vm_size_t alloc, const char *name)
/xnu-2422.115.4/iokit/IOKit/
H A DIOBufferMemoryDescriptor.h76 vm_size_t _capacity;
87 vm_size_t capacity,
136 vm_size_t capacity,
141 vm_size_t capacity,
165 vm_size_t capacity,
198 vm_size_t capacity,
203 vm_size_t withLength,
216 vm_size_t withLength,
230 virtual void setLength(vm_size_t length);
246 virtual vm_size_t getCapacit
[all...]
H A DIOLib.h83 void * IOMalloc(vm_size_t size);
93 void IOFree(void * address, vm_size_t size);
102 void * IOMallocAligned(vm_size_t size, vm_offset_t alignment);
110 void IOFreeAligned(void * address, vm_size_t size);
120 void * IOMallocContiguous(vm_size_t size, vm_size_t alignment,
129 void IOFreeContiguous(void * address, vm_size_t size) __attribute__((deprecated));
139 void * IOMallocPageable(vm_size_t size, vm_size_t alignment);
147 void IOFreePageable(void * address, vm_size_t siz
[all...]
/xnu-2422.115.4/bsd/dev/dtrace/
H A Ddtrace_alloc.c51 vm_size_t dtrace_alloc_max;
52 vm_size_t dtrace_alloc_max_prerounded;
87 vm_size_t size;
112 void *dtrace_alloc(vm_size_t size)
115 vm_size_t allocsize;
138 void dtrace_free(void *data, vm_size_t size)
141 vm_size_t freesize;
/xnu-2422.115.4/osfmk/ipc/
H A Dipc_table.c81 vm_size_t elemsize);
101 vm_size_t elemsize) /* size of elements */
104 vm_size_t minsize = min * elemsize;
105 vm_size_t size;
106 vm_size_t incrsize;
177 vm_size_t size)
202 vm_size_t size,
/xnu-2422.115.4/osfmk/default_pager/
H A Ddefault_pager_types.h52 vm_size_t dpi_total_space; /* size of backing store */
53 vm_size_t dpi_free_space; /* how much of it is unused */
54 vm_size_t dpi_page_size; /* the pager's vm page size */
60 vm_size_t dpi_page_size; /* the pager's vm page size */
96 vm_size_t dpo_size; /* backing store used for the object */
/xnu-2422.115.4/osfmk/mach/i386/
H A Dvm_types.h107 * A vm_size_t is the proper type for e.g.
112 typedef uintptr_t vm_size_t; typedef
114 typedef natural_t vm_size_t; typedef
/xnu-2422.115.4/osfmk/mach/
H A Dvm_map.defs94 out size : vm_size_t;
115 size : vm_size_t;
131 size : vm_size_t);
152 size : vm_size_t;
167 size : vm_size_t;
180 size : vm_size_t;
217 size : vm_size_t;
231 size : vm_size_t;
233 out outsize : vm_size_t);
239 size : vm_size_t;
[all...]
/xnu-2422.115.4/osfmk/mach_debug/
H A Dzone_info.h82 vm_size_t zi_cur_size; /* current memory utilization */
83 vm_size_t zi_max_size; /* how large can this zone grow */
84 vm_size_t zi_elem_size; /* size of an element */
85 vm_size_t zi_alloc_size; /* size used for more memory */
/xnu-2422.115.4/osfmk/x86_64/
H A Dcopyio.c44 static int copyio(int, user_addr_t, char *, vm_size_t, vm_size_t *, int);
45 static int copyio_phys(addr64_t, addr64_t, vm_size_t, int);
64 extern int _bcopy(const void *, void *, vm_size_t);
65 extern int _bcopystr(const void *, void *, vm_size_t, vm_size_t *);
79 vm_size_t nbytes, vm_size_t *lencopied, int use_kernel_map)
83 vm_size_t bytes_copied;
231 copyio_phys(addr64_t source, addr64_t sink, vm_size_t csiz
[all...]

Completed in 52 milliseconds

1234567